Understanding Soundproofing
Soundproofing is the process of reducing the amount of sound that passes through a structure. Sound travels in waves, and these waves can be absorbed, reflected, or transmitted. The goal of soundproofing is to minimize the transmission of sound waves from one side of a structure to the other.


When it comes to apple cabins, there are several factors that influence their soundproofing capabilities. One of the most important factors is the materials used in construction. High - quality insulation materials play a crucial role in soundproofing. For example, fiberglass insulation is a popular choice. It works by trapping air within its fibers, which helps to absorb sound waves. As sound waves hit the insulation, the energy is dissipated as heat, reducing the amount of sound that can pass through.
Another material that can enhance soundproofing is mass - loaded vinyl. This dense, flexible material is often used in walls and floors. Its high mass helps to block sound waves, preventing them from traveling through the structure. Additionally, double - glazed windows can significantly improve soundproofing. The air gap between the two panes of glass acts as an insulator, reducing the transmission of sound.
Design Features for Soundproofing in Apple Cabins
The design of an apple cabin also has a major impact on its soundproofing. A well - sealed cabin is essential. Any gaps or cracks in the walls, floors, or ceilings can allow sound to leak through. We ensure that all joints in our apple cabins are properly sealed using weatherstripping and caulking. This not only helps with soundproofing but also with energy efficiency.
The layout of the cabin can also affect soundproofing. For instance, separating noisy areas such as kitchens or mechanical rooms from quiet areas like bedrooms can reduce the spread of sound within the cabin. We design our apple cabins with this in mind, creating functional spaces that minimize sound interference.
In addition, the shape of the cabin can play a role. Rounded or curved walls can help to diffuse sound waves, preventing them from bouncing directly off surfaces and causing echoes. This can create a more acoustically pleasant environment inside the cabin.

Limitations and Considerations
While our apple cabins offer excellent soundproofing, it's important to note that there are limits. Extremely loud noises, such as explosions or very close - range heavy machinery, may still be audible to some degree. Also, the effectiveness of soundproofing can be affected by factors such as the age of the cabin and how well it has been maintained.
Over time, seals may wear out, and insulation may become less effective. Regular maintenance, such as checking and replacing weatherstripping and caulking, can help to ensure that the soundproofing performance remains optimal.
